SYNTHESIS AND CONFORMATION OF R-(+)-2-(α-PHENYLETHYL)BENZOPHENONE

Masayuki Ako, Shunsuke Takenaka

Open publisher page 14 citations

Abstract

Abstract As a model of chiral benzophenone, R-(+)-2-(α-phenylethyl)benzophenone was prepared. The NMR and optical data indicate that rotations of the benzoyl and α-phenylethyl moieties are unrestricted in the range of −100 to 150°C, and therefore benzophenone skeleton is not chiral. A preferable conformation is discussed.
